i was using the tractor the other day with the tractor shovel and got hung up on a tree stub i was moving.the tractor was on a pretty good incline and justshut down. i checked fuel which was 3/4 full ,checked spark,coolent all the simple stuff (i think?) checked fuel filter could blow air right through it.put the filter back on removed air per operators manual.couldn't get fuel to circulated again.took of seat and pulled the fuel pump fuel pump would run when i put jumpers on it out of the tank.when i put the pump and sensor back in the tank i checked the power at the pig tail comming from the tractor i had power to the tank sensor but not to the fuel pump.is there a fuel shut off thant i dont know about like in a car ? the tractor was running fine before i got on the incline btw the tractor has less than 50 hours on any ideas would help im about 100 miles away from a jd dealer thanks in advance andy

Is the tractor still stuck on the incline? If so it could be a low oil pressure condition that is preventing the tractor from starting-I believe there is a pressure switch to protect the engine.

How steep is the incline? There should be an oil pressure or oil level sensor that will shut the engine down and this could be your problem. I would also check for any wires pulled loose. If it doesn't start on level ground then you may have other problems.

Eddie, it sounds like you blew the fuse in the dash area. remove the side panels, reach deep in the wires, you are looking for a blue fuse with masking tape over it.
